Why is it that the Processor Occupancy in practice is far less than that of a race, and what graphics adjustments can I make to compensate for this? (In other words, what can I live with and live without in the graphics options?)

Seems particularly worse at Spa! (especially at the bus stop chicane and at the braking point to the first corner!

Game runs as smooth as silk in practice, but start a race and the play slows down considerably in some areas.

Also, what frame rate should I use when the game suggests a certain frame rate (eg. 22 FPS)? Should I manually set it higher, lower, or leave as is?




Windows XP
Dell Pentium 4 - 1.6 gh processor
80 gb hard drive @ 7200rpm
256 mb Ram
64 mb nvidia geforce 2 mx/mx400 video card
GP4 patch version 9.6 installed
GPXPatch331 installed

The Processor Occupancy (PO) will always be higher in a race because it has to draw more cars on screen and has to process where all the cars are on the track, and work with them. In practice, there is less cars so less for the CPU to do, which means more for the preformace of the game

Often chaing settings in the gfx area within the game will not make much difference. But tweaking outside of GP4 will be required, in GP4s config files. The file which i use dropped my PO down to 100%, and uped my FPS to 33 from 20.

Also remember that the PO display takes some PO power. You can see the effect for yourself by pressing and holding the "O" key. If the processor is being worked, the game will slow down when the key is pressed.

Better off using FRAPS really.
